What Happens in Your Body
When you get anxious, your brain sends out a signal, like a shout: “Hey, something is happening!” This signal tells your body to be ready for action, just like when you hear thunder before a big storm.
Your heart might race, and your breathing could speed up. But sometimes, this extra energy can also make parts of your body feel numb or tingly, especially in your hands or feet. It’s like when you squeeze a balloon too hard, it goes all wobbly and strange.
Why Numbness & Tingling Happen
Think about when you get really excited or scared, and you hold your breath for a moment, that’s what happens with anxiety. Your body might be using up so much energy being ready for action that it forgets to send the right messages to your hands and feet, making them feel numb or tingly, just like when you stand on your toes too long and your feet go all tingly! Anxiety can make your body feel like it’s going on a wild rollercoaster ride, numbness and tingling are like the sudden drops and twists you feel when you're scared.

Examples
- A person feels their hands go numb when they're nervous before a big presentation.
- During an exam, someone starts to feel tingling in their feet due to stress.
- A student gets numbness in their arms after a panic attack.
